英文摘要
A ruthenium(II)-bipyridine complex chemiluminescent measurement of folic acid related compounds has been examined and developed a useful HPLC-CL method. The developed method was successfully applied to quantify folic acid in tablets and supplements. This means the method might be useful for the quality control of these materials. On the other hand, application of the method to folic acid related compounds except for 5-methyltetrahydrofolic acid in biomaterials was not always successful due to the less stability of these compounds and the lower sensitivity of the method. Improvement of the method concerning the conditions such as stabilizing agent and so on, are required.
